Well, many people think that Kiyomizu-dera Temple opens around 9:00 a.m., you know, around 9:00 a.m. or 8:00 a.m., but actually, Kiyomizu-dera Temple is open from 6:00 a.m. I wonder if there are many other temples and shrines that are open from 6:00 a.m. I don’t think there are many places that are open from 6:00 a.m. Not really. I feel that more and more every year. Yes, this is… Kiyomizu Stage, isn’t it? People used to jump off here… There used to be a lot of people jumping off from here. If you jump off over there and survive, your wish will come true. So, in the past… Everyone risked their lives to make their dreams come true, … …and there was a culture of jumping off from here. That’s Kiyomizu Stage. And the spot where you can take beautiful pictures of Kiyomizu Stage is over there. That’s why there are so many people. We’re probably in a lot of those pictures. Yes.   7. 江戸時代では店の主人が病気になったのを憂い病気が治るようにと雇われている若い女の人が願掛けのために飛んだと記録が残っています。人の命を救うために自らの命を差し出すところに江戸時代の様子がうかがえます。
